Balcombe train station offers a range of facilities to make your travel experience comfortable and convenient. The ticket office is open from 6:30 AM to 2:30 PM Monday through Saturday. For those in need of purchasing or collecting tickets at other times, worry not, as the station boasts accessible ticket machines that offer transport with Disabled Persons Railcard discounts. If you’ve bought your tickets online, simply collect them at a designated machine.
The station is partially accessible, with step-free access available to platform 1 for trains heading to London. For those travelling towards Brighton, a footbridge access is required. Although Balcombe lacks certain amenities like waiting rooms and accessible toilets, it does have a comfortable seating area for travelers to relax while waiting for their trains. Additionally, CCTV at the station ensures added safety, while customer help points on the platforms provide assistance at any time of the day.
Upon arriving at Balcombe, travelers can easily transition to other modes of transport, ensuring a seamless journey. The station provides detailed onward travel information, including local bus services which can be referenced online. Although the station doesn’t host extensive car services, there is ample parking space operated by APCOA Parking UK, available 24/7. However, it's worth noting that while there are two accessible spaces, accessible equipment is not present.

Kirknewton station operates without a ticket office, so passengers are encouraged to purchase tickets online in advance of their trip because there are no ticket machines available for collection. Smartcards are a convenient solution for regular travelers, and, fortunately, Kirknewton is equipped with smartcard validators. Additionally, there are customer help points to aid travelers, and the station is secure with CCTV surveillance, ensuring a safe environment for all railway users.
While some step-free access is provided, visitors should note that there is a single Blue Badge parking bay and step-free access across the station. The station lacks a ramp for train access, so travelers with specific mobility needs should plan accordingly. There are no toilets or refreshment facilities, so guests are advised to prepare ahead of their visit. For those requiring assistance, the station is part of the Passenger Assist program, allowing for assistance booking in advance.
Traveling onward from Kirknewton is a breeze, with buses available from a stop conveniently located at the station's pedestrian entrance. You can visit Travel Line Scotland for full details about available bus services, and taxi services can be organized via the handy Train Taxi website when required.
